I think you can spend a very full day floating from Tokul to Fall city. You can also go all the way down to Neal Rd. I always do one section or the other. You can spend half a day in the pool that ends at the Fall city ramp, for that matter. I have rowed up to the top of that and fished the riffle at the top more times than I can count. Makes for a good workout and a nice 2 to 3 hour fishing trip.

If you haven't rowed the upper section before, there is a spot about half way down that is interesting to row through at low water. It's sort of a narrow chute that want's to push you into a rock wall. Fun. It will be interesting to see what it gets shaped into with this high water. It's not tricky if you know what you're doing, but it wouldn't be what I'd want to row into on my first time on the oars. It's plenty visible from above, and probably won't be any problem at 2000 cfs flows or above.
